Physics-informed machine learning: A mathematical framework with applications to time series forecasting

物理信息机器学习(PIML)是一种将物理知识嵌入机器学习模型的新兴框架,其物理先验通常以需满足的偏微分方程(PDE)系统形式存在。本文第一部分分析PIML方法的统计性质,研究物理信息神经网络(PINNs)在逼近性、一致性、过拟合和收敛性方面的特性,并将其转化为核方法,从而应用核岭回归工具深入理解其行为。基于该核形式,我们开发了新型物理信息算法并高效实现于GPU。第二部分探讨工业应用场景,包括在异常时期对能源信号进行预测,展示来自智能出行挑战赛的电动车充电占用结果,并分析出行模式对电力需求的影响。最后,提出一种物理约束的时间序列建模框架,应用于多国的负荷与旅游需求预测。

Physics-informed machine learning (PIML) is an emerging framework that integrates physical knowledge into machine learning models. This physical prior often takes the form of a partial differential equation (PDE) system that the regression function must satisfy. In the first part of this dissertation, we analyze the statistical properties of PIML methods. In particular, we study the properties of physics-informed neural networks (PINNs) in terms of approximation, consistency, overfitting, and convergence. We then show how PIML problems can be framed as kernel methods, making it possible to apply the tools of kernel ridge regression to better understand their behavior. In addition, we use this kernel formulation to develop novel physics-informed algorithms and implement them efficiently on GPUs. The second part explores industrial applications in forecasting energy signals during atypical periods. We present results from the Smarter Mobility challenge on electric vehicle charging occupancy and examine the impact of mobility on electricity demand. Finally, we introduce a physics-constrained framework for designing and enforcing constraints in time series, applying it to load forecasting and tourism forecasting in various countries.
